The Inugami Family
The Inugami Family (犬神家の一族, Inugami-ke no Ichizoku) is a 1976 Japanese film directed by Kon Ichikawa. The film is the 1st in Kon Ichikawa and Kōji Ishizaka's Kindaichi Series. Ichikawa would remake the film in 2006 as The Inugamis.
